Tecan’s remote monitoring for automation goes up a notch

Tecan, building on the success of its Common Notification System (CNS) for the remote monitoring of automation, presented the latest upgraded version at ALA’s LabAutomation 2010 conference in Palm Springs, California, USA.
CNS, standard with every Freedom EVOware® software package, allows the user to monitor the status of every Freedom EVO® liquid handling system within the network of the company, via a web browser or using the Tecan CNS iPhone® application. Version 2, due for release shortly, further extends this function to enable reliable monitoring via the 3G network from outside the company, and can actively send status updates to an iPhone by push notifications.
Eskil Trollhagen, product manager for Freedom EVOware and TouchTools Suite™, explained: “CNS Version 2 is not dependent on the customer’s technical infrastructure, operating instead via the cell phone network, making it even easier to set up and use, as well as making it much more powerful. The application can be set to alert the user, for example, when a reagent refill is needed or upon completion of a run. The ability to react and to recover interrupted runs further increases the rate of success, significantly saving time and money. CNS effectively increases walkaway time by providing operators with added security and peace of mind when leaving the laboratory. This unique functionality boosts our customers’ confidence in using automation.”
